> On 08 Jul 2015, at 16:57, Martyn Welch <martyn.we...@ge.com> wrote: > > > > On 07/07/15 11:52, Dmitry Kalinkin wrote: >> The API I had in mind would have only vme_master_read and >> vme_master_write that would take absolute addresses (not relative to >> any window). These variants of access functions would then try to >> reuse any window that is already able to serve the request or wait >> for a free window and reconfigure it for the need of the request. > > I'm a little concerned by the latency this might cause, especially if there > is one device which is negatively affected by latency. Handling RORA > interrupts would be "interesting" if all the windows were dynamically > allocated at the time at which an interrupt came in. Latency-critical windows can be statically allocated using current resource based API. _______________________________________________ devel mailing list de...@linuxdriverproject.org http://driverdev.linuxdriverproject.org/mailman/listinfo/driverdev-devel
- [PATCHv3 10/16] vme: ca91cx42: fix LM_CTL address mask Dmitry Kalinkin
- [PATCHv3 08/16] staging: vme_user: provide DMA functio... Dmitry Kalinkin
- Re: [PATCHv3 08/16] staging: vme_user: provide DM... Greg Kroah-Hartman
- Re: [PATCHv3 08/16] staging: vme_user: provid... Martyn Welch
- Re: [PATCHv3 08/16] staging: vme_user: pr... Dmitry Kalinkin
- Re: [PATCHv3 08/16] staging: vme_user... Martyn Welch
- Re: [PATCHv3 08/16] staging: vme... Dmitry Kalinkin
- Re: [PATCHv3 08/16] staging:... Alessio Igor Bogani
- Re: [PATCHv3 08/16] staging:... Dmitry Kalinkin
- Re: [PATCHv3 08/16] staging:... Martyn Welch
- Re: [PATCHv3 08/16] staging:... Dmitry Kalinkin
- Re: [PATCHv3 08/16] staging:... Alessio Igor Bogani
- Re: [PATCHv3 08/16] staging:... Dmitry Kalinkin
- Re: [PATCHv3 08/16] staging:... Martyn Welch
- Re: [PATCHv3 08/16] staging:... Dmitry Kalinkin
- [PATCH] vme: lower alignment... Dmitry Kalinkin
- Re: [PATCHv3 08/16] staging:... Martyn Welch
- Generic VME UIO driver Dmitry Kalinkin
- Re: Generic VME UIO driver Martyn Welch
- Re: [PATCHv3 08/16] staging:... Martyn Welch
- [PATCHv3 06/16] vme: check for A64 overflow in vme_che... Dmitry Kalinkin